The Sejong Police Agency's violent drug crime unit said it has arrested two people, including a man in his 50s, for secretly growing and storing hemp in the mountains.

They are accused of cultivating 67 weeks of hemp in the hills of Unjusan Mountain in Sejong and Gongju in Chungcheongnam-do for the past six months, harvesting some and storing them in kimchi refrigerators.

They have been secretly cultivating hemp by cultivating land in the deep mountains where there is no human traffic.

Police say they seized KRW 340 million worth of hemp, including 67 weeks of hemp, 2.3 kilograms of dried hemp leaves and 57 grams of seeds, and are continuing their investigation into the seller.
